Mae Ishmael, Realtor - The Hudson Team Realtor® serving Bryan/College Station and the surroundings areas! Mae Ishmael is a Texas native and grew up in Magnolia, TX.

She pursued a collegiate softball career at the University of Texas at Tyler and placed third in the nation at the World Series in 2011. She was accepted to Texas A&M University in the Spring of 2012 and graduated in 2014 with a BA in International Studies. During her time at A&M, she enjoyed a study abroad in France and an internship with the United States Coast Guard in Miami, Florida. Mae began

her career in Real Estate in 2015 serving Bryan/College Station and the surrounding counties. Mae works with both buyers and sellers, whether it’s their first home or their forever home. She specializes in the parent of student and investment market around Texas A&M with extensive knowledge on the communities and developments around the University. She also has helped many clients navigate the market from out of town. She prides herself on her work ethic and good communication with clients. In her spare time she enjoys being outdoors, riding her horses, going to Aggie sports events, and spending time with her family.
